This course is offered through the National Centre for Groundwater Management in collaboration with the Faculties of Engineering and Science. It is designed to enable students to develop specialist skills in the area of groundwater management, including aspects of geology, hydrology, hydraulics and resource management.
The course provides a multidisciplinary perspective to issues of groundwater management for students working in this area or recent graduates who would like to specialise in the field.
Groundwater studies provide students with industry-desired skills in managing groundwater resources and contaminated sites. This course covers all aspects of fundamental hydrogeology, geochemistry, groundwater modelling, geostatistics and site characterisation that allow students to contribute immediately to the groundwater industry.
Career options include hydrogeologist, groundwater modeller, hydrologist and groundwater consultant.
Applicants should possess an Honours degree in the Earth Sciences from UTS or an equivalent qualification from another recognised tertiary institution. Applicants are also required to submit a curriculum vitae.
The course may be completed in one year of full-time study, or two-and-a-half to three years of part-time study.
It may be taken in block attendance or distance mode. Both block and distance modes are available in Autumn semester, however, only distance mode is available in Spring semester.
Students must complete 60 credit points of study, made up of four core subjects, two electives (another approved subject may replace one of the electives) and a groundwater science project.
